Scientific Models
Tools used by scientists to analyze complex processes, predict possible outcomes, improve scientific understanding, and study systems that are too small or too large.
Limitations of Models
The drawback of models, specifically that they simplify reality.
Building a Model
The process where scientists start with a small amount of data and build up a better representation of phenomena over time.
Mathematical Models
Models that are mathematical and run on computers rather than being a visual representation, while following the same principle.
Testing Ideas
A use of models that makes it much easier to work with a representation than with an entire system, such as carbon dioxide in the atmosphere.
Making Test Predictions
A use of models to predict the future based on observations and determine what types of changes can be expected.
Communication
A use of models to transfer ideas to other people and help them visualize ideas or abstract concepts.
